How they compare

Azerbaijan currently reports 0.0021 Mt CO2e against 0.0021 Mt CO2e in Namibia, a difference of 0 Mt CO2e.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 55 shared years of data; in 1970 it was Azerbaijan ahead.

Azerbaijan ranks 134th and Namibia ranks 134th of 194 countries.

Across the 6 decades both report, Azerbaijan averaged higher in 4 and Namibia in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Azerbaijan Namibia Difference Ahead
1970s 0.0081 Mt CO2e 0.0008 Mt CO2e 0.0073 Mt CO2e Azerbaijan
1980s 0.0094 Mt CO2e 0.0009 Mt CO2e 0.0085 Mt CO2e Azerbaijan
1990s 0.0048 Mt CO2e 0.0002 Mt CO2e 0.0046 Mt CO2e Azerbaijan
2000s 0.0022 Mt CO2e 0.0004 Mt CO2e 0.0017 Mt CO2e Azerbaijan
2010s 0.0014 Mt CO2e 0.0016 Mt CO2e 0.0002 Mt CO2e Namibia
2020s 0.0021 Mt CO2e 0.0022 Mt CO2e 0 Mt CO2e Namibia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

A measure of annual emissions of nitrous oxide (N2O), one of the six Kyoto greenhouse gases (GHG), from industrial combustion (subsector of the energy sector) including IPCC 2006 code 1.A.2 Manufacturing Industries and Construction. The measure is standardized to carbon dioxide equivalent values using the Global Warming Potential (GWP) factors of IPCC's 5th Assessment Report (AR5).
